PD is characterised by a speedy loss of midbrain dopaminergic neurons. The main endeavor for using human ESC cells to treat PD was by using the generation of dopaminergic-like neurons, later human iPSCs was proposed as a substitute to overcome ESCs controversies (27). Both cells introduced hope for acquiring an infinite supply of dopaminergic neurons as an alternative to the previously made use of fetal Mind tissues. Subsequently, protocols that mimicked the development of dopaminergic neurons succeeded in building dopaminergic neurons similar to that with the midbrain which ended up ready to survive, combine and functionally mature in animal versions of PD preclinically (28). According to the investigate offered by diverse teams; the “Parkinson’s Worldwide Force” was shaped which aimed toward guiding researchers to improve their cell characterization and enable endorse the clinical development toward effective therapy.

Embryonic stem cells (ESCs) have a chance to divide indefinitely even though trying to keep their pluripotency, that's manufactured attainable by means of specialized mechanisms of cell cycle control.[37] When compared to proliferating somatic cells, ESCs have unique cell cycle attributes—such as rapid cell division attributable to shortened G1 section, absent G0 period, and modifications in cell cycle checkpoints—which leaves the cells generally in S section at any supplied time.

The company ViaCyteTM in California just lately initiated a section I/II trial (NCT02239354) in 2014 in collaboration with Harvard University. This demo entails 40 patients and employs two subcutaneous capsules of insulin developing beta cells generated from ESCs. The outcome shall be appealing due to relieve of monitoring and Restoration in the transplanted cells. The preclinical experiments stem cell therapy previous this trial shown effective glycemic correction along with the equipment were being productively retrieved just after 174 days and contained practical insulin-creating cells (forty one).

Stem cells have been properly isolated from human enamel and had been analyzed to test their capacity to regenerate dental constructions and periodontal tissues. MSCs have been documented for being productively isolated from dental tissues like dental pulp of long-lasting and deciduous tooth, periodontal ligament, apical papilla and dental follicle (forty two-forty four). These cells were being referred to as an excellent cell resource owing for their relieve of accessibility, their capability to differentiate into osteoblasts and odontoblasts and deficiency of ethical controversies (45). What's more, dental stem cells shown remarkable capabilities in immunomodulation Homes both through cell to cell conversation or by means of a paracrine outcome (forty six). Stem cells of non-dental origin have been also recommended for dental tissue and bone regeneration.

The neural stem cells self-renew and sooner or later changeover into radial glial progenitor cells (RGPs). Early-fashioned RGPs self-renew by symmetrical division to kind a reservoir group of progenitor cells. These cells transition to your neurogenic point out and start to divide asymmetrically to provide a sizable variety of a variety of neuron kinds, Each and every with special gene expression, morphological, and functional attributes. The process of producing neurons from radial glial cells is named neurogenesis.
